In episode 57 of The Popko Project podcast, I sit down with Aaron Bruch, bass player and backing vocalist for the rock band Breaking Benjamin.

I’ve had the pleasure of knowing Aaron and calling him a friend of mine for over 15 years. I’ve seen him perform solo gigs throughout Northeastern, Pennsylvania and in bands like Pan.a.ce.a and OurAfter before getting his big break in Breaking Benjamin.

We talk about what it was like going back out on tour after 500+ days of not playing a single show, what Northeastern, Pennsylvania means to him and the band, their homecoming show at Montage Mountain last month, his new business venture with Parlor Beverages, the Red Sox, and so much more.
